Book High Temperature Corrosion of Ceramics

Download or read book High Temperature Corrosion of Ceramics written by J.R. Blachere and published by William Andrew. This book was released on 1989-12-31 with total page 208 pages. Available in PDF, EPUB and Kindle. Book excerpt: The information in this book is from a 1987 Dept. of Energy report of the same title. Materials investigated in this particular study are silica, alumina, silicon nitride and silicon carbide. Book Corrosion of High Performance Ceramics

Download or read book Corrosion of High Performance Ceramics written by Yury G. Gogotsi and published by Springer Science & Business Media. This book was released on 2012-12-06 with total page 192 pages. Available in PDF, EPUB and Kindle. Book excerpt: "Corrosion of High-Performance Ceramics" is a comprehensive survey of the state of the art of this new field of research. It presents the first generalized description of the corrosion of engineering ceramics and its effect on their mechanical properties (based on Si3N4, SiC, AlN, B4C, BN, Al2O3, ZrO2). Researchers, engineers and graduate students are provided with a guide to the performance of non-oxide and oxide ceramicsin corrosive environments. Book Materials Under Extreme Conditions

Download or read book Materials Under Extreme Conditions written by A.K. Tyagi and published by Elsevier. This book was released on 2017-01-13 with total page 870 pages. Available in PDF, EPUB and Kindle. Book excerpt: Materials Under Extreme Conditions: Recent Trends and Future Prospects analyzes the chemical transformation and decomposition of materials exposed to extreme conditions, such as high temperature, high pressure, hostile chemical environments, high radiation fields, high vacuum, high magnetic and electric fields, wear and abrasion related to chemical bonding, special crystallographic features, and microstructures. The materials covered in this work encompass oxides, non-oxides, alloys and intermetallics, glasses, and carbon-based materials.
